Last wednesday (07.05.2008) while I was driving my one week old Ducati Monster 696 from work to home,
I crashed into a deer.
I slided approx. 8 meters with the deer on front and after that bounced from side to side 11 meters with the bike. Last slide was approx. 58 meters with my left hand under the bike. Somehow my backpack got attached to the bike handles so I wasn't able to get rid of the bike while sliding. After the bike stopped I got up and took my helmet and gloves off.
I was swearing a lot and started to take cigarettes out of my pocket, thats when I realized that half of my finger was missing...
Then I started to scream and yell until a car came to the scene and I was able to stop them so they could call help.
I got to smoke one cigarette before the ambulance came and took me to the hospital. Luckily I was close to Helsinki so they took me to hospital where was great hand surgeon. They amputated half of the finger off.
I'm still very happy of the outcome. It could have ended a lot worst. I think most of the compliments for my survival with minimal damage goes to the great motorcycle clothing and safety gear I had on.
So remember bikers, wear your safety gear! You never know what can happen...
